What Is a Tractor Autosteer System?
At its core, a tractor autosteer system automates the steering of farming vehicles using GPS and sensor data. This reduces the need for manual corrections and keeps the tractor on precise paths during planting, spraying, or harvesting.
Dealers should emphasize that autosteer offers:
- Improved accuracy: Lines are straighter, overlaps and skips minimized.
- Consistent performance: Reduces driver fatigue and errors over long hours.
- Cost savings: Efficient field coverage protects inputs and boosts yields.
Core Components of Autosteer Systems
Understanding the hardware and software involved allows dealers to troubleshoot and demonstrate value effectively.
GNSS Receiver
This module gathers satellite signals (GPS, GLONASS, Beidou) to determine the tractor’s exact position with centimeter-level accuracy. High-end receivers from Hi-Target use multi-constellation RTK technology for robust signals even in challenging environments.Steering Controller Unit
The brain of the autosteer system, it integrates position data and calculates steering commands. This unit interfaces directly with the tractor’s steering mechanism, activating hydraulic or electric actuators to guide the wheels.Heading Sensor & IMU
Inertial Measurement Units (IMUs) and heading sensors track orientation and movement dynamics, ensuring smooth course corrections to maintain line accuracy during turns or uneven terrain.User Interface (Display & Controls)
Operators interact with the system via intuitive displays that show routes, guidance lines, and system status. Hi-Target’s smart terminals offer customizable layouts, making it easy for farmers to set boundaries, shifts, and implement guidance patterns.
How Does Autosteer Keep Tractors on Track?
Autosteer relies on real-time satellite data combined with vehicle dynamics:
- The GNSS receiver constantly updates the tractor’s position.
- The controller compares this position to a predefined path.
- If deviation occurs, the steering controller sends commands to correct the wheel angle.
- Sensors continuously feed orientation data to smooth out adjustments and avoid sudden jerks.
This closed-loop feedback system ensures precise line following regardless of variables like soil conditions or slope.
